Your offensive plays:

Inside Run, Outside Run, Draw, Screen Pass, Short Pass, Medium Short Pass, Medium Pass, Medium Long Pass, Long Pass

Your Defensive Plays:


RUN DEFENSES: Run Defense, Run Blitz, Inside Run Defense, Outside Run Defense

NEUTRAL DEFENSES All Purpose, All Purpose Tight, Blitz Linebacker, Blitz Safety, Blitz All

PASS DEFENSES: Bump And Run, Standard Man, Soft Man, Standard Zone, Deep Zone, Prevent

Keys, double teams, shadow QB are available. An Extra DB (defensive back) modifier is available for all passing defenses and Blitz Safety and Blitz Linebacker.

Individual player ratings are used for sacks and interceptions, while all other defensive factors are grouped as a team.

I really like the passing game/pass defense in this game which directly accounts for Yards After Reception. Throw a short pass pass (right at the line of scrimmage) with the defense in medium or long depth and see if your receiver can come up with with a bigger gain. There is a "die roll " for the completion and another one for the RAC. Of course the outcome is based on the players and randomness.

Just a few tweaks separate Version 8 from Version 9 such as an increased blitz effect on draw plays and a strengthening of the blitz effect on passes. The screens and interface are the same.

I think Version 10 comes out this summer. The program is totally redone and the screens are going to be unrecognizable from any previous edition.

With Second and Ten a quick free download gets you all NFL teams and seasons dating back to 1932.
